Nacogdoches Medical Center is a 161-bed acute care facility serving as the anchor of NMC Health Network for more than 40 years. Designed to improve access to healthcare services in Nacogdoches and Shelby counties and the surrounding communities, NMC specializes in emergency services, women’s health, cardiovascular medicine and surgery, open heart surgery, cancer care, orthopedics, neurology and neurosurgery. Extensions of the network include Imaging Services, the Ambulatory Surgery Center of Nacogdoches, Wound Care, Loma Laird Cancer Center and Shelby County Emergency Services.

The Holy Cross Medical Group (HCMG) and Holy Cross Hospital is seeking a board-certified or board eligible Urologist to join our dynamic and growing team in Fort Lauderdale, Florida.
This is a full-time opportunity offering a competitive compensation package, including a generous sign-on bonus to support your transition. You'll be part of a collaborative medical environment with access to advanced technology, a robust referral network and opportunities for professional development.
The selected candidate will join two Urology physicians and two APPs in a hospital-based practice.
The schedule for this opportunity is a five-day work week spending three to four days in clinic and one to two days in the operating room. The practice call for this opportunity is 1:5 shared with community physicians and ER call coverage is, on average, 4 shifts per month.
The ideal candidate will have an interest in General Urology, Female Urology, Reconstruction, and/or Prosthetics and Robotic/Minimally invasive surgery. Teaching and mentorship qualities are highly desired.
